Description
This is an early 19th century red brick farmhouse, located on Barford Road (or Wellesbourne Road) in Wasperton. The house is constructed with a plain tile roof featuring gabled ends, and extends to three storeys over three bays. It has sash windows with glazing bars. The central doorway is framed by a pilastered surround, topped with a rectangular fanlight and a flat hood supported by brackets. Brick chimney stacks are situated at the ends of the building.
